Abstract
In this paper, a neural-adaptive cubature Kalman filter (NACKF) algorithm is proposed for tracking the global position system (GPS) signal under dynamic environments. Although the adaptive cubature Kalman filter (ACKF)-based tracking loops overcome the inherent limitation of traditional cubature Kalman filter (CKF)-based tracking loops, which require the prior statistics of the measurement noise, the performance of ACKF-based tracking loops may degrade under dynamic environments due to the uncertainty of the system model such as mismodelling. To improve the performance of the ACKF-based tracking loop, a multilayer feed-forward neural network (MFNN) is embedded in the ACKF algorithm. In the proposed NACKF-based tracking loop, the multilayer feed-forward neural network (MFNN) is used to approximate the uncertainty of the system model; and the CKF is used for both MFNN online training and state estimation simultaneously. To effectively evaluate the performance of NACKF-based tracking loop this paper deeply compares the proposed method with the CKF-and ACKF-based tracking loops in medium dynamic environments and high dynamic environments, respectively. The analytical and experimental results showed that the performance of the NACKF-based tracking loop outperforms those of the CKF-and ACKF-based tracking loops under dynamic environments.
